Abstract

A method for manufacturing an optoelectric device may include the steps of providing a layer of an optoelectric active material between a first electrode and a second electrode, providing a patterned electrically insulating layer structure at least one of said electrodes, the patterned electrically insulating layer structure having openings, providing an electrolyte in said openings, and depositing a metallic layer in said openings from the electrolyte by electroplating, wherein the electrolyte is formed by an ionic liquid.

Claims (8)

1 . Optoelectric device comprising:

a layer of an optoelectric active material between a first electrode and a second electrode;

a patterned electrically insulating layer structure on at least one of said electrodes, the patterned electrically insulating layer structure having openings; and

a metallic structure on the patterned electrically insulating layer structure that extends through the openings of the patterned electrically insulating layer to the at least one of the electrodes, therewith directly contacting said at least one of the electrodes.

2 . Optoelectric device according to claim 1 , comprising a stack with a further layer of an optoelectric active material between a third electrode and a fourth electrode, said stack being arranged on the patterned electrically insulating layer structure provided with the metallic structure.

3 . Optoelectric device according to claim 2 , wherein both the layer of an optoelectric active material and the further layer of an optoelectric active material is a light-emitting layer.

4 . Optoelectric device according to claim 2 , wherein the layer of an optoelectric active material is a light-emitting layer and the further layer of an optoelectric active material is a photo-voltaic layer.

5 . Optoelectric device according to claim 2 , wherein the layer of an optoelectric active material is a light-emitting layer and the further layer of an optoelectric active material is an electrochromic layer.
